Originally introduced earlier this year, Xiaomi’s Redmi Note smartphone features a 5.5-inch 1280x720p HD display, 1.7GHz octa-core MediaTek MT6592 processor, 2GB of RAM, and Android 4.3 with MIUI v5. Xiaomi has already promised to provide MIUI v6 update for Redmi Note but that will be arriving next year.
Xiaomi had already revealed the price of Redmi Note at the time of Mi 3 release – INR 9,999, but given our experience with Redmi 1S, there could be a last minute reduction in the price. As you can expect, the company will be following its flash sale method for Redmi Note too. So, if you want to purchase the smartphone, get ready for the rush.
